Body Protection Compound 157 is a synthetic peptide derived from a protein found in gastric juice. Extensively studied for its role in tissue regeneration, gut health, and angiogenesis in preclinical models.
A synthetic version of the naturally occurring peptide Thymosin Beta-4. Research suggests TB-500 may play a role in actin regulation, cell migration, and tissue repair mechanisms across multiple biological systems.
A synergistic peptide stack combining a GHRH analogue (CJC-1295) with a selective GH secretagogue (Ipamorelin). Studied for their combined effect on growth hormone pulsatility and IGF-1 expression in research models.
A novel triple agonist peptide targeting GIP, GLP-1, and glucagon receptors simultaneously. Among the most promising compounds under study for metabolic regulation, appetite modulation, and energy expenditure research.
